Irshad Bhatti responds to criticism over Meera’s interview

Senior journalist Irshad Bhatti has responded in detail to the criticism surrounding his controversial interview with actress Meera, giving a new direction to the ongoing debate on social media.

Bhatti stated that the questions he asked during the interview were the same ones that had already been widely discussed in the media.

According to him, his intention was not to humiliate anyone but to fulfill his role as a journalist by asking relevant questions. He also clarified that Meera was invited to the podcast through a media company and was paid, as she usually does not give interviews for free.

It is worth noting that Meera appeared on the podcast to promote her upcoming film “Psycho.” However, when the conversation shifted toward her personal life, past controversies, and sensitive topics, she repeatedly tried to steer it back to her film. When the questioning continued, she chose to leave the interview midway, which sparked strong criticism of Bhatti on social media.

In his vlog, Bhatti said that if anyone is offended by his questions, he is willing to apologize. However, he maintained that there was no rudeness or personal attack in the interview. He also expressed disappointment that even some of his close associates criticized him.

In an emotional tone, he questioned whether men in society also have dignity and can feel harassment, and why every issue is framed through a gender lens. He added that many people formed opinions without watching the full podcast, which he считает unfair.

Bhatti concluded by saying that he respects Meera, and if she felt hurt by his questions, he would not hesitate to apologize to her.
